VILLADA, Juan D.; DUARTE-RUIZ, Álvaro and CHAUR, Manuel N.. Regiospecific synthesis and electrochemical study of two water-soluble C60 carboxylic derivatives. Rev. acad. colomb. cienc. exact. fis. nat. [online]. 2021, vol.45, n.174, pp.272-285. Epub Sep 18, 2021. ISSN 0370-3908. https://doi.org/10.18257/raccefyn.1187.
We report a new methodology for the synthesis of two highly symmetric equatorial malonate hexaadducts of C60 fullerene. The synthetic methodology is based on a series of protection and deprotection steps that allow the preparation of a fullerene [60] functionalized with six symmetrical positioned malonate addends without using complicated and expensive separation techniques (high-performance liquid chromatography, HPLC) or long reaction times. This methodology allowed us to prepare the carboxylic adducts 6 (equatorial octacarboxylic tetraadduct of C60) and 8 (equatorial dodecacarboxylic hexakisadduct of C60). As far as we know, compound 6 has not yet been reported. We also studied the electronic properties of the main compounds by UV-Vis spectroscopy and cyclic voltammetry (CV). The reported fullerene adducts exhibited several reversible reduction processes whose electron transfers are controlled by diffusion.
